DATES:  June 17-22, 2024  

 

FORMAT: 36-holes of individual stroke play at gross played the first two days.  Low 64 players advance to Match Play.  A tie for the final qualifying spot(s) will result in a hole-by-hole playoff to be held Wednesday morning at 6:30 a.m.    

 

FIELD SIZE:  144 players for the qualifying rounds, with the field cut to the top 64 players for the Match Play Championship, all competing in one division.

CADDIES: Caddies are NOT permitted for the stroke play qualifying on Monday and Tuesday.  Caddies are however allowed for the match play rounds on Wednesday through Saturday.  They must agree to walk unless there is an available seat in one of the player’s carts. Caddies riding in a cart MUST NOT displace a player.

 

GOLF CARTS: The use of golf carts is included in the registration fee; however, players are permitted to walk if interested.  AGA Cart policy (maximum of two riders per cart and maximum of two carts per group) will be enforced.   

 

In addition, the following policies will be enforced:

  • Spectator carts are not permitted for insurance reasons, NO EXCEPTIONS.
  • Carts are assigned only to contestants.  A caddie may use a cart only if a contestant is not displaced by such use.
  • Restrictions on cart use for players are at the discretion of the Host Site and all players are bound by those requirements, subject to withdrawal for violations of that policy.  Any such restrictions will be posted at the tournament site.
  • Carts must be kept on paths if available near greens and tees.
  • Any non-player riding with a player is considered a caddie and subject to any potential Rules violations.
  • Pull carts are permitted as long as not in conflict with the Host Club rules.

 

WITHDRAW POLICY:  

  • Players who withdraw prior to the close of registration will receive 75% of the entry fee, regardless of reason. (TPA members get 100% if they withdraw prior to close of registration.)
  • Players who withdraw after the close of registration and prior to 72 hours of the qualifier will receive 50% of the entry fee, regardless of reason.
  • Players who withdraw within 72 hours (3 days) of the first day of the event, will not receive a refund.
